Mining and Geological Engineers, Including Mining Safety Engineers Salary in Michigan

The median annual wage for Mining and Geological Engineers, Including Mining Safety Engineers in Michigan is $125,600 (May 2024 BLS OES). The mean (average) is $114,870.

Pay spans roughly $62,500 at the 10th percentile to $160,090 at the 90th, so experience and specialisation move this figure a lot. At the median that is about $60.38 per hour. An estimated 80 people work as mining and geological engineers, including mining safety engineers in Michigan.
